Key Trends in Auto Parts Innovation and Technology

The auto parts industry is rapidly evolving, driven by technology and innovation. As we approach 2026, several key trends are shaping the market. One significant trend is the rise of electric vehicle (EV) components. Manufacturers are focusing on producing lighter, more efficient parts. This change is essential for enhancing the range and performance of EVs. Advanced materials, such as carbon fiber and lightweight alloys, are gaining traction. These materials contribute to better energy efficiency, which is highly desired.

Another important trend is the integration of smart technology into auto parts. Sensors and connectivity features are becoming standard in new components. This shift allows for real-time monitoring of vehicle performance. For example, advanced diagnostics can alert drivers about potential issues before they become serious. However, there are challenges in ensuring data security and managing software updates effectively. Many buyers are still skeptical about implementing fully connected systems.

Sustainability continues to be a significant concern. The industry is under pressure to reduce its environmental impact. Recycling and reusing materials is becoming a priority. Many companies are exploring circular economy models. Yet, the transition can be complex. Not all manufacturers are prepared to shift their processes to meet these new standards. Essential Auto Parts Categories for Global Buyers

When exploring essential auto parts categories for global buyers, the focus must be on reliability and performance. Engine components rank high on this list. They include items like camshafts, pistons, and gaskets. Each part plays a crucial role in ensuring vehicle efficiency. Buyers should prioritize parts made with durable materials. Quality can impact whether engines run smoothly and last long.


Another key category is suspension parts. These components enhance ride quality and handling. Shocks and struts keep vehicles stable on various terrains. Familiarity with the specifications for weight and load is vital.

Selecting the wrong suspension part can lead to safety issues. Therefore, buyers must evaluate their needs carefully.


Braking systems also deserve attention. Reliable brakes are paramount for safety. Brake pads, discs, and calipers should be of high quality. Flaws in these parts can lead to significant risks. It’s essential to consider where and how often vehicles will be used. Understanding these details can be challenging for some buyers. Engaging with knowledgeable suppliers can bridge this gap.
